36 FS::log_context - Object methods for log_context records
42 $record = new FS::log_context \%hash;
43 $record = new FS::log_context { 'column' => 'value' };
45 $error = $record->insert;
47 $error = $new_record->replace($old_record);
49 $error = $record->delete;
51 $error = $record->check;
55 An FS::log_context object represents a context tag attached to a log entry
56 (L<FS::log>). FS::log_context inherits from FS::Record. The following
57 fields are currently supported:
61 =item logcontextnum - primary key
63 =item lognum - lognum (L<FS::log> foreign key)
65 =item context - context
